Ignition lock is OK, becouse there is power supply on instruments, VECU and other systems. Ignition lock actuate 3 relays: K1 - 15R (radio), K2 - kl15 - ignition, K3 - Body builder relay. K4 - starter enable ralay. actuated with VECU on some models, generally with Volvo D12D/D13 engine.
